Wednesday 27 June - Sunday 1 July 2012
Each summer, Henley-on-Thames is brought to life with the Henley Royal Regatta. The Regatta, first held in 1839, is a unique rowing event offering 100 world-class races over five days & the chance to see Britain's Olympic stars, while enjoying a day of lavish hospitality & elegance on the banks of the Thames.The regatta is a great hospitality option, offering a haven of relaxation within easy striking distance of London.
Two primary venues are available for the Henley Regatta: Temple Island and Fawley Meadows. Situated by the start line, Temple Island is a private space & has a fantastic view of the length of the course. Albert Roux personally introduces his menu before lunch, which is accompanied by a selection of fine wines. A private space hosting only 40, Temple Island is ideally suited to exclusive hire for the day, making a presonal, relaxed hospitality experience.
If you prefer to mix with other parties, then Fawley Meadows is an appealing alternative, with a number of private areas dotted along the river bank. The hospitality village also offers a chill-out zone that is exclusive to Fawley Meadows guests. There's also a complimentary alfresco bar, live music & comfy seating on offer.
